Occupational Work Experience

Earn units on the job

The Occupational Work Experience (OWE) Program is designed for college students who are enrolled in a course(s) at San Joaquin Delta College, while working as paid or non-paid/volunteer employees. As a participant of the program, you may earn from 1- 4 units of general college credit per participating semester. You may earn a maximum of 16 units from this program. The goal of this program is to help you develop marketable skills, abilities, attitudes and work habits appropriate to successful employment in a career field!
